The popular "500 Series" takes its hippest, most fun approach yet, with an intoxicatingly vibrant and technically diverse collection of contemporary jewellery. Juror Susan Kasson Sloan has put together a groundbreaking survey of the best work being done with this thoroughly modern material. Every page offers some delightful items, with pieces that stretch from the subtle and sublime to the fantastically humorous. There's jewellery that tells a story and jewellery that cleverly incorporates recycled materials - including sunglass lenses and knitting needles. In true 21st century style, much of the work is being designed and produced with cutting-edge CAD CAM technologies. The extremely talented artists include Jantje Fleischhut; Lisa and Scott Cylinder; Adam Paxon; Felieke van der Leest; Ted Noten; Svenja John; Pavel Herynek; Karin Seufert; and Margaux Lange.

Juror Susan Kasson Sloan is a self-taught jeweller with a background in fine arts. Her work is exhibited at the Renwick Gallery, Washington, DC; the Victoria & Albert Museum, London and many more.
